Address

NTCL3967yebj3Q9rzh9S7GqBzGHdTUppkF

0 XNA

Confirmed
Total Received542.10346143 XNA
Total Sent542.10346143 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NTCL3967yebj3Q9rzh9S7GqBzGHdTUppkF542.10346143 XNA
 
 
NTCL3967yebj3Q9rzh9S7GqBzGHdTUppkF542.10346143 XNA